Wow. Just wow. This may have been my favorite Wonder Woman story ever. Wonder Woman finds herself in a post apocalyptic Earth with no idea what's happened. Forced to piece together the tragic story of how the apocalyptic was brought forth we see Wonder Woman attempt to help the survivors
while wrestling with her own tragic past. As the story unfolds, we get shock after shock. The art work is gritty and the story is bleak yet hopeful. I plan to purchase this, it was that good.

A gonzo supernatural professional wrestling romp with a soul!
Lona Steelrose teams up with the masked wrestler who killed her mother in the ring for a chance at resurrecting her mom in a necromancer's other-worldly tag-team tournament. Along the way she confronts her self doubts and her estranged father, but mostly it is pure wrestling MAYHEM!!!
Goofy, kinetic fun with some emotional gut punches.

Did you see that scene in the most recent season of Stranger Things where the guy plays guitar on the roof of a trailer in the Upside Down as bat creatures swirl around? This comic is basically 200 pages of that.
Despite withdrawing from everyone he loves due to depression from a personal tragedy, Jake is yanked back into the world, drafted to fight monsters from another dimension by using his heavy metal guitar licks to pump up the hit and attack points of a giant falcon with a mechanical show more arm and a murderous hatred of monsters.
Meant to be read fast, preferably with lots of heavy metal music blasting in the background, it's sort of dumb but also very fun. show less
